    Single backfire?

    I went to fire up the bike yesterday and after a couple of presses of the go button "boom" it had a massive backfire (which coincidentaly hit the garage door ) then it started and ran perfectly as usual.

    What could cause it to do that?

    I've been riding it most days, the only thing I can think of is that I had to switch to the reserve tank a couple of days before could it have been a bit of crud?

    Most likely unburnt fuel down the exhaust pipe from turning over without firing. When it did fire, the gas in the pipe ignited.

    Back in the olden days when I drove my Dad's vehicimickles, it was rated as "fun" to switch off the ignition key when driving along, keep the accelerator down for maybe four five seconds and then turn ignition back on. If you did it right you got a big fat backfire when all the unburnt gas that passed into the exhaust system lit up...

    But I got in the shit because one day the muffler fell off and he reckoned it was my fault...
